Why cedar shake for a Wilmette home

Architectural match

Cedar Shake is the historically correct specification for a meaningful share of Wilmette's mature tree-lined housing stock. Replacing in kind preserves the architectural character that makes these homes what they are.

Lifespan

Properly installed cedar shake on a Chicagoland home delivers 25-30 years of service life with periodic maintenance — longer on roofs with good attic ventilation.

Property value

On mature tree-lined Wilmette properties, premium roofing materials are part of the home's market identity. Specifying cedar shake or a credible alternative preserves the comparable-sales position relative to the neighborhood.

What cedar shake roofing costs in Wilmette

Pricing depends on roof square footage, complexity, material grade selection, copper flashing scope, and existing condition. Here's the realistic range for Wilmette properties:

Standard Cedar Shake
$80,000 to $150,000

Single-family home, typical square footage, standard material grade with proper flashing.

Estate-tier projects
$130,000 to $250,000+

Larger homes, complex rooflines, premium material grades, full copper flashing scope, and architectural-review submission where required.

Repairs & restoration
$8,000 to $30,000

Targeted cedar shake repairs, course replacements, flashing-only work, or restoration scopes on otherwise sound roofs.
